package feign;
/**
* An {@code Observer} is asynchronous equivalent to an {@code Iterator}.
*
* Observers receive results as they are
* {@link feign.codec.IncrementalDecoder decoded} from an
* {@link Response.Body http response body}. {@link #onNext(Object) onNext}
* will be called for each incremental value of type {@code T} until
* {@link feign.Subscription#unsubscribe()} is called or the response is finished.
*
* {@link #onSuccess() onSuccess} or {@link #onFailure(Throwable)} onFailure}
* will be called when the response is finished, but not both.
*
* {@code Observer} can be used as an asynchronous alternative to a
* {@code Collection}, or any other use where iterative response parsing is
* worth the additional effort to implement this interface.
*
*
* Here's an example of implementing {@code Observer}:
*
*
* Observer counter = new Observer() {
*
* public int count;
*
* @Override public void onNext(Contributor element) {
* count++;
* }
*
* @Override public void onSuccess() {
* System.out.println("found " + count + " contributors");
* }
*
* @Override public void onFailure(Throwable cause) {
* System.err.println("sad face after contributor " + count);
* }
* };
* subscription = github.contributors("netflix", "feign", counter);
*
*
* @param expected value to decode incrementally from the http response.
*/
public interface Observer {
/**
* Invoked as soon as new data is available. Could be invoked many times or
* not at all.
*
* @param element next decoded element.
*/
void onNext(T element);
/**
* Called when response processing completed successfully.
*/
void onSuccess();
/**
* Called when response processing failed for any reason.
*
* Common failure cases include {@link FeignException},
* {@link java.io.IOException}, and {@link feign.codec.DecodeException}.
* However, the cause could be a {@code Throwable} of any kind.
*
* @param cause the reason for the failure
*/
void onFailure(Throwable cause);
}
